Output a8fbfc64efa0df3385c3b24498576d1ebb6719c24da06a2c11127d5aa3f72ae9:1

value
27998998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e14c0f2929b3096417dbb864971993219480fe0d OP_EQUAL
address
3NEH5PkEYtZvp9UC3bqpKU6xJAif99o3vU
transaction
a8fbfc64efa0df3385c3b24498576d1ebb6719c24da06a2c11127d5aa3f72ae9
confirmations
376871
spent
true